Frequently Asked Questions about Duclay Forest
How much are Studio apartments in Duclay Forest?
There are currently 5 Studio Apartments in Duclay Forest with rent ranges from $715 to $1,305 with an average price of $1,096.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Duclay Forest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Duclay Forest ranges from $799 to $1,800 with an average monthly rent of $1,205.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Duclay Forest c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Duclay Forest range from $802 to $2,050.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,386.
How expensive are Duclay Forest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 26 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Duclay Forest on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,150 to $2,299 - averaging $1,555 for the location.
